Supermodel Niki Taylor's aunt, Mary Eaton, said this weekend that relatives are encouraged by Taylor's rapid recuperation from a near-fatal car crash on April 29. "I talked to my sister (Barbara, Niki's mother) last night and she said Niki's doing great," Eaton, told the Atlanta Journal Constitution for Saturday's editions. Taylor, 26, remains on a respirator and is unable to speak, "but she's able to point to a sign board to communicate with the family," said her aunt. "She told them she wants to go home." A spokeswoman for Atlanta's Grady Memorial Hospital said that Taylor remains in critical but stable condition, and may remain in intensive care several more weeks. Taylor sustained liver and other injuries when the driver of the car she was riding in lost control of the vehicle when he was distracted by a ringing cell phone.
